Metroworks - Natick Center/MBTA

Coworking Space in Natick, Massachusetts

Metroworks - Natick Center/MBTA main image

Contact Information

5 (2 reviews)

Hours of Operation

Monday: 9AM-5PM

Tuesday: 9AM-5PM

Wednesday: 9AM-5PM

Thursday: 9AM-5PM

Friday: 9AM-5PM

Saturday: Closed

Sunday: Closed


Visit Official Website

About Metroworks - Natick Center/MBTA

Metroworks - Natick Center/MBTA is a coworking space located in Natick, Massachusetts.

Accessibility

  • Wheelchair accessible parking lot

Location

1 South Ave Suite 2, Natick, Massachusetts 01760